| def _extend_freeze_support() -> None: | ||||
|     """Extend multiprocessing.freeze_support() to also work on Non-Windows for spawn.""" | ||||
|     # upstream issue: https://github.com/python/cpython/issues/76327 | ||||
|     # code based on https://github.com/pyinstaller/pyinstaller/blob/develop/PyInstaller/hooks/rthooks/pyi_rth_multiprocessing.py#L26 | ||||
|     import multiprocessing | ||||
|     import multiprocessing.spawn | ||||
| 
 | ||||
|     def _freeze_support() -> None: | ||||
|         """Minimal freeze_support. Only apply this if frozen.""" | ||||
|         from subprocess import _args_from_interpreter_flags | ||||
| 
 | ||||
|         # Prevent `spawn` from trying to read `__main__` in from the main script | ||||
|         multiprocessing.process.ORIGINAL_DIR = None | ||||
| 
 | ||||
|         # Handle the first process that MP will create | ||||
|         if ( | ||||
|             len(sys.argv) >= 2 and sys.argv[-2] == '-c' and sys.argv[-1].startswith(( | ||||
|                 'from multiprocessing.semaphore_tracker import main',  # Py<3.8 | ||||
|                 'from multiprocessing.resource_tracker import main',  # Py>=3.8 | ||||
|                 'from multiprocessing.forkserver import main' | ||||
|             )) and set(sys.argv[1:-2]) == set(_args_from_interpreter_flags()) | ||||
|         ): | ||||
|             exec(sys.argv[-1]) | ||||
|             sys.exit() | ||||
| 
 | ||||
|         # Handle the second process that MP will create | ||||
|         if multiprocessing.spawn.is_forking(sys.argv): | ||||
|             kwargs = {} | ||||
|             for arg in sys.argv[2:]: | ||||
|                 name, value = arg.split('=') | ||||
|                 if value == 'None': | ||||
|                     kwargs[name] = None | ||||
|                 else: | ||||
|                     kwargs[name] = int(value) | ||||
|             multiprocessing.spawn.spawn_main(**kwargs) | ||||
|             sys.exit() | ||||
| 
 | ||||
|     if not is_windows and is_frozen(): | ||||
|         multiprocessing.freeze_support = multiprocessing.spawn.freeze_support = _freeze_support | ||||
| 
 | ||||
| 
 | ||||
| def freeze_support() -> None: | ||||
|     """This behaves like multiprocessing.freeze_support but also works on Non-Windows.""" | ||||
|     import multiprocessing | ||||
|     _extend_freeze_support() | ||||
|     multiprocessing.freeze_support() | ||||
